    Quote Originally Posted by YemeniAntillean View Post
    rs3829241 A/G

    rs35264875 A/A

    rs1805005 T/G


    wut dis mean? i have black-brown hair...
    One risk allele on Val60Leu and one on TPCN2 rs3829241. You had good chances to have been born with blond or light brown hair. You have good chances to possess a blond or blondish beard.
